Thoughts on Krashen

Thoughts on the Krashen Article
Casey Kiel

He did an excellent job summing up his ideas in the video.  Krashen stated, “We acquire language when we understand messages.”  Students must have comprehensible input or messages they can understand.  In the application section of the article the author discusses that teaching formulas and rules is not teaching language; it just teaches language appreciation.  He goes on to describe a scenario where the student is motivated and the teacher is excellent at teaching grammar in a clear and meaningful way.  The student is confident and their affective filter is low.  Even then when language is acquired it is a result of the means and not of the subject taught.  This article drives home the importance of teaching through actual communication and experience rather than just skill and drill.
